Commons Dilemma

A situation in which individuals' short-term selfish interests are at odds with long-term group benefits and social sustainability.

Prisoner's Dilemma

A situation in game theory where two individuals acting in their own self-interest pursue a course of action that does not result in the ideal outcome for either of them.

Cost-of-living Raises

Adjustments in salary or wages to counteract inflation, ensuring the purchasing power of an employee's income remains steady.
